Output 393657560107e8cfb3e8cc12ee3d6c0da66507f4d44a4ab15064f6277c0ff887:1

value
24217500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b1ab80f0e5203e08ae90627a9cf8b3b80372ba8 OP_EQUALVERIFY OP_CHECKSIG
address
1J4KNLhEc7YTs6RyWHhM7GTyb9dn39in5z
transaction
393657560107e8cfb3e8cc12ee3d6c0da66507f4d44a4ab15064f6277c0ff887
spent
true